Exactly what is LPG And just how is it designed?
LPG stands for liquefied petroleum gasoline and is a variety of 'liquid gas' which might be employed as gasoline for many different purposes, like powering cars.
Also often called butane and propane fuel, or autogas in motoring circles, it is the by-merchandise of the processing of normal fuel liquids along with the refining of crude oil.
When historically it had been deliberately burnt off and wasted, in the previous couple of many years it has been recognised as a flexible low-carbon fuel – and utilised productively.
Even though the phrase ‘liquid gasoline’ seems to generally be a contradiction in conditions, it actually describes a clear gas that turns to liquid when subjected to stress or cooling: it’s this characteristic that permits it for being stored in tanks within a motor vehicle.
Most petrol autos is usually equipped by having an LPG (Liquid Petroleum Gasoline) conversion, turning them into ‘dual-fuel vehicles’ that could run on LPG in addition to petrol. Some brand names, including Dacia, have offered conversions in the factory.

Why can it be not more broadly made use of?
Though LPG is commonly used by houses and corporations, lower than one particular p.c of cars on UK streets are fuelled by it.
There are a variety of main reasons why Lots of people are reluctant to convert their auto to operate on LPG but considered one of the biggest factors is the lack of incentives from your United kingdom Federal government.
While autos transformed by permitted corporations may perhaps qualify to save lots of on car or truck excise obligation (VED), by currently being classed as an ‘alternatively-fuelled’ vehicle, the latest guidelines mean these only save £ten a year on road tax.
Very like electrical automobiles, it’s a ‘chicken and egg’ state of affairs. With LPG-converted cars symbolizing these kinds of a small proportion of all motor vehicles on United kingdom roads, there’s very little incentive for filling stations to offer LPG. And when it’s hard to find filling stations stocking it, motorists will be hesitant to convert to LPG.
Many of us don’t fully grasp the benefits and drawbacks of operating an LPG motor vehicle. Without the similar incentives as electric autos, LPG merely isn’t staying promoted in the UK. Quite a few motorists merely aren’t mindful of its existence.
Motorists can also be concerned about the price. Changing a petrol automobile to operate on LPG can Price tag approximately £two,000, and there’s no warranty in the United kingdom governing administration that it received’t raise duties on LPG Later on. How readily available is LPG?
Another reason why Many of us are reluctant to transform their vehicle to operate on LPG is The issue in finding gas stations that provide it.
Based on the British isles trade association to the LPG industry, UKLPG, you can find one,400 LPG refuelling stations across the country when compared to about 8,350 filling stations Over-all.
Meaning it’s more difficult to seek out LPG than petrol or diesel, particularly when you reside inside a rural spot where by filling stations are scarcer.
It's acquiring easier to Find LPG stockists, however. There are actually now numerous Web sites and mobile phone apps displaying your nearest LPG supplier, and in some cases allowing you Examine charges.
Quite a few the large fuel station chains at times supply LPG, like Shell, BP and Esso, as do supermarket petrol stations, notably some Morrisons and Sainsbury’s stations.
